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) provide a flexible solution for residents facing mental health challenges, allowing them to receive treatment without the barriers of commuting.
For those living in Avery, Virtual IOP presents an opportunity to engage in structured therapy while maintaining daily responsibilities. With sessions offered several days a week, individuals can participate in evidence-based treatments such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) from the comfort of their homes. This accessibility is particularly beneficial for balancing work, school, or family obligations, making mental health care more attainable.
Starting a Virtual IOP is straightforward: after selecting a program that meets your needs, you can connect with licensed therapists through HIPAA-compliant video conferencing.
